Finance Review Summary — Licensing Dispute, Hallowick Components

The dispute with Tessmark Industrial over the Corvid-9 licence remains unresolved. Our exposure is estimated at mid six figures, with accrued provisions booked in Q3. Counsel advises settlement is likelier than arbitration, and cash-flow impact would fall in the next fiscal year. The finance team should note the planning implication recorded below.

confidential, hawif-kagup: Only 16 of the 552 pilot accounts renewed Ralix, so a churn review is set for November 1. Quenysox Group is in early talks to buy Ralethix Partners for about $63.3 million.

Present: full leadership team. Apologies: none.

1. Pilot with retail chain Marsten & Quill approved. Six stores, eight weeks, Driftline product range only.
2. Logistics to confirm shelf-ready packaging by end of month.
3. Data-sharing terms agreed; weekly sell-through reports to Commercial.
4. Success criteria: 12% uplift versus control stores.
5. No public comment until pilot concludes. All queries route through the Commercial office.

Next review in four weeks. The pilot connects to broader plans noted confidentially below.

confidential, kagep-kahof: Druokax Systems plans to lower the Ulaath list price by 53 percent in March.

Subject: Contrast audit on-call — getting started

Welcome aboard. You'll be on call for the Huemark contrast audit pipeline, which scans Tilde Suite screens nightly and flags components below our ratio thresholds. Most pages are false positives from gradient backgrounds; triage those first before escalating to the design systems group. The triage workflow, threshold table, and suppression process are all documented on the internal audit page.

operations page: https://confluence.tolvaqsys.corp/spaces/pages/pages/6e787158f507